Let the number of Blue casset be b and that of green be g.
Thus the total number of cassets will be:
b+g=16
hence
g=16-b.......i
The total amount was:
45b+55g=830..ii
plugging i in ii we get:
45b+55(16-b)=830
45b+880-55b=830
simplifying
45b-55b=830-880
-10b=-50
thus
b=5
hence
g=16-5=11
number of blue cassets was 5 and that of green was 11

The center of the clock is taken as the origin.The clock is a circle with a diameter 10 units.Radius is half the diameter .Radius = 10 ÷2= 5 units.
The clock is divided in four quadrants .On x axis y=0 and on y axis x=0.
When it is 12 o'clock the hour hand is on positive of y axis.Coordinates of the point at 12 o'clock=(0,5)
When it is 3 o 'clock the hour hand is on positive of x axis .Coordinate of the point at 3o'clock is (5,0)
When it is 6 o'clock the hour hand is on negative of y axis .The coordinates of the point at 6o'clock is (0,-5)
At 9o'clock the hour hand is on negative of x axis .The coordinate of the point at 6o'clock is(-5,0)
